A/74/120 I. Introduction 1. At its seventy-third session, the General Assembly adopted two resolutions under agenda item 96 on developments in the field of information and telecommunications in the context of international security. 2. On 5 December 2018, the General Assembly adopted resolution 73/27 on developments in the field of information and telecommunications in the context of international security and on 22 December, it adopted resolution 73/266 on advancing responsible State behaviour in cyberspace in the context of international security. 3. In paragraph 4 of resolution 73/27, the General Assembly invited all Member States, taking into account the as sessments and recommendations contained in the reports of the Group of Governmental Experts on Developments in the Field of Information and Telecommunications in the Context of International Security, to continue to inform the Secretary-General of their views and assessments on the following questions: (a) General appreciation of the issues of information security; (b) Efforts taken at the national level to strengthen information security and promote international cooperation in this field; (c) The content of the concepts mentioned in paragraph 3 of the resolution; (d) Possible measures that could be taken by the international community to strengthen information security at the global level. 4. In paragraph 2 of resolution 73/266, the General Assembly invited all Member States, taking into account the assessments and recommendations contained in the reports of the Group of Governmental Experts, to continue to inform the Secretary General of their views and assessments on the following questions: (a) Efforts taken at the national level to strengthen information security and promote international cooperation in this field; (b) The content of the concepts mentioned in the reports of the Group of Governmental Experts. 5. Pursuant to that request, on 6 February 2019, a note verbale was sent to all Member States inviting them to provide information on the subject. The replies received at the time of reporting are contained in section II. Additional replie s received after 15 May 2019 will be posted on the website of the Office for Disarmament Affairs (www.un.org/disarmament/ict-security) in the original language received. II.
